Before your consultation, ensure you have all relevant documents about your injury. It includes medical records, accident reports, photographs, insurance policies, and evidence related to your case. You should provide these materials to your lawyer during the consultation to assess the merits of your claim more accurately.

Legal fees and payment

It’s crucial to discuss the lawyer’s fee structure and payment arrangements during the initial consultation. Most brampton personal injury law firm work on a contingency fee basis, which means receiving a payment successfully recover compensation on your behalf? This arrangement is beneficial because it allows individuals with limited financial resources to pursue their claims without upfront costs.
